Andrew's git
/
gitweb.git
/ diff
summary
|
log
|
commit
| diff |
tree
commit
grep
author
committer
pickaxe
?
re
gitk: Get rid of the diffopts variable
author
Paul Mackerras
<paulus@samba.org>
Sat, 6 Oct 2007 10:22:00 +0000
(20:22 +1000)
committer
Paul Mackerras
<paulus@samba.org>
Sat, 6 Oct 2007 10:22:00 +0000
(20:22 +1000)
The only thing that could be specified with diffopts was the number
of lines of context, but there is already a spinbox for that. So
this gets rid of it.
Signed-off-by: Paul Mackerras <paulus@samba.org>
gitk
patch
|
blob
|
history
raw
|
patch
|
inline
| side by side (parent:
308ff3d
)
diff --git
a/gitk
b/gitk
index 3f7f77777def2f936ddacd1e0fc122c5121c16f2..290deff7b223c9baea87219b9a7e2560d537fcdd 100755
(executable)
--- a/
gitk
+++ b/
gitk
@@
-5119,14
+5119,13
@@
proc getblobline {bf id} {
}
proc mergediff {id l} {
}
proc mergediff {id l} {
- global diffmergeid
diffopts
mdifffd
+ global diffmergeid mdifffd
global diffids
global parentlist
set diffmergeid $id
set diffids $id
# this doesn't seem to actually affect anything...
global diffids
global parentlist
set diffmergeid $id
set diffids $id
# this doesn't seem to actually affect anything...
- set env(GIT_DIFF_OPTS) $diffopts
set cmd [concat | git diff-tree --no-commit-id --cc $id]
if {[catch {set mdf [open $cmd r]} err]} {
error_popup "Error getting merge diffs: $err"
set cmd [concat | git diff-tree --no-commit-id --cc $id]
if {[catch {set mdf [open $cmd r]} err]} {
error_popup "Error getting merge diffs: $err"
@@
-5333,11
+5332,10
@@
proc diffcontextchange {n1 n2 op} {
}
proc getblobdiffs {ids} {
}
proc getblobdiffs {ids} {
- global
diffopts
blobdifffd diffids env
+ global blobdifffd diffids env
global diffinhdr treediffs
global diffcontext
global diffinhdr treediffs
global diffcontext
- set env(GIT_DIFF_OPTS) $diffopts
if {[catch {set bdf [open [diffcmd $ids "-p -C --no-commit-id -U$diffcontext"] r]} err]} {
puts "error getting diffs: $err"
return
if {[catch {set bdf [open [diffcmd $ids "-p -C --no-commit-id -U$diffcontext"] r]} err]} {
puts "error getting diffs: $err"
return
@@
-8000,7
+7998,7
@@
proc chg_fontparam {v sub op} {
}
proc doprefs {} {
}
proc doprefs {} {
- global maxwidth maxgraphpct
diffopts
+ global maxwidth maxgraphpct
global oldprefs prefstop showneartags showlocalchanges
global bgcolor fgcolor ctext diffcolors selectbgcolor
global uifont tabstop
global oldprefs prefstop showneartags showlocalchanges
global bgcolor fgcolor ctext diffcolors selectbgcolor
global uifont tabstop
@@
-8011,7
+8009,7
@@
proc doprefs {} {
raise $top
return
}
raise $top
return
}
- foreach v {maxwidth maxgraphpct
diffopts
showneartags showlocalchanges} {
+ foreach v {maxwidth maxgraphpct showneartags showlocalchanges} {
set oldprefs($v) [set $v]
}
toplevel $top
set oldprefs($v) [set $v]
}
toplevel $top
@@
-8037,10
+8035,6
@@
proc doprefs {} {
label $top.ddisp -text "Diff display options"
$top.ddisp configure -font uifont
grid $top.ddisp - -sticky w -pady 10
label $top.ddisp -text "Diff display options"
$top.ddisp configure -font uifont
grid $top.ddisp - -sticky w -pady 10
- label $top.diffoptl -text "Options for diff program" \
- -font optionfont
- entry $top.diffopt -width 20 -textvariable diffopts
- grid x $top.diffoptl $top.diffopt -sticky w
frame $top.ntag
label $top.ntag.l -text "Display nearby tags" -font optionfont
checkbutton $top.ntag.b -variable showneartags
frame $top.ntag
label $top.ntag.l -text "Display nearby tags" -font optionfont
checkbutton $top.ntag.b -variable showneartags
@@
-8141,10
+8135,10
@@
proc setfg {c} {
}
proc prefscan {} {
}
proc prefscan {} {
- global maxwidth maxgraphpct
diffopts
+ global maxwidth maxgraphpct
global oldprefs prefstop showneartags showlocalchanges
global oldprefs prefstop showneartags showlocalchanges
- foreach v {maxwidth maxgraphpct
diffopts
showneartags showlocalchanges} {
+ foreach v {maxwidth maxgraphpct showneartags showlocalchanges} {
set $v $oldprefs($v)
}
catch {destroy $prefstop}
set $v $oldprefs($v)
}
catch {destroy $prefstop}
@@
-8479,7
+8473,6
@@
proc tcl_encoding {enc} {
# defaults...
set datemode 0
# defaults...
set datemode 0
-set diffopts "-U 5 -p"
set wrcomcmd "git diff-tree --stdin -p --pretty"
set gitencoding {}
set wrcomcmd "git diff-tree --stdin -p --pretty"
set gitencoding {}